Chumoukedima, November 21 (MTNews): Nagaland Police and Christian Institute of Health Sciences & Research (CIHSR) signed a Memorandum of Understanding today at Rhododendron Hall, Police Complex, Chumoukedima.

 

 

Renchamo P. Kikon, IPS ADGP (Adm) and Dr. Sedevi Angami, Director CIHSR executed project “SAHYOG”, an initiative of Nagaland Police for availing subsidized health care service to IRB personnel and their dependents.
It was mentioned that a dedicated Facilitation cum Reception Counter has already been set up at CIHSR exclusively for IRB personnel.

 

SAHYOG is an initiative conceptualized and initiated by IGP IR Sonia Singh IPS for the welfare of IR families who are relentlessly supporting their men and women in IR Bn to serve the state and nation.

 

The project aims at providing subsidized medical treatment at CIHSR Referral Hospital, Dimapur to IR personnel and their families including spouses, kids and parents. This pilot project shall be gradually extended to all police personnel in the state of Nagaland.

 

Project SAHYOG is an endeavor to extend a bond of care and affection to police families and empower them by delivering basic services at their doorstep so as to ease the mental stress of the police personnel who are performing their bonafide duties in and outside the state of Nagaland.

 

In its first phase, project SAHYOG aims to provide subsidized medical treatment at Referral Hospital, to provide SAHYOG smart cards to all IR men and women and SAHYOG utility App for booking online medical appointments.
